Most SmartSVN commercial licenses are per-user. You can generally use your license file on multiple machines (e.g., your work laptop and home desktop) provided you are the sole person utilizing the software.

Yes, the Foundation edition is free for any use, including commercial use, but with a reduced feature set compared to Professional edition.
